FAQ

Frequently Asked Questions

Q. What is a domain name?

Simply put, your domain name is the address of your website.

Q. Will you register my domain name for me?

We can, but prefer not to because we want you to always maintain control of your domain.

Sometimes a designer or 3rd party will register your domain in their account, under their name. You may find that they have retained ownership of the domain and you don’t have access to the account. Later, if you need to change designers you may encounter a problem.

If you would like help, we would be happy to help walk you through the steps, but it is a very easy process. Regardless, if we help, your domain will always remain in your control.

Q. Do I need hosting?

Yes, all websites have to be hosted. Think of your website as being your business’ digital house and your hosting is the digital land where the house is located.

Q When I register my domain name should I sign up for hosting?

We prefer that you register your domain and purchase your hosting at the same time. Most domain registrars offer hosting packages, and most hosting companies offer domain registration when you purchase hosting from them.

If you have already registered a domain but choose to use a different hosting service, you will have to move the domain from the original registrar to the new hosting company. Sometimes there is a fee to do this. If you register your domain and purchase your hosting at the same time, it can save you money and time.

If you have already registered a domain, no worries. We will either purchase hosting through the same company or transfer your domain to another hosting service.

Q. How long does it take to build a site?

It all depends on how big a site you want, what features you want to be included, what are your goals for the site, and how quickly the client can provide the material (images and content) to the designer.

A simple, two-page site might be graphically laid out in a day, but if the client takes a week to provide the material, then the site will take a week to complete. A large e-commerce site could take weeks. Often, even after the original site is created, changes and updates continue as your online business evolves.

The only way to accurately estimate how long it will take to build your site is to have an in-depth conversation with your web designer about exactly what kind of site you want and set up a timetable for providing the content.

Q. How much does a website cost to design?

The cost of your site depends on many factors:
– How many pages will it have
– How many special applications it will have (photo gallery, blog, product catalog, shopping cart, etc.)
– If there is any media to be used (video, music, etc.)
– Will you be using online forms
– and others

The only way a designer can tell you how much a website will cost is to talk with you to get a clear understanding of exactly what you want. Even then, as a job progresses, the estimate for a site may change as you decide to change or add pages, applications, or other elements to your website.

Other factors to consider in the price are the hosting fees and the costs to keep your site updated.

Q. Do I own the art and design and all of the files for my site?

The answer is both Yes and No. Yes, if we design artwork or have content written specifically for you, you will own the rights. You will maintain the rights to ALL of the content you provide for the site. If we use stock images or a general design, those things will not belong to you, as you are not the creator.

Q. How often should I update my site?

As often as you need to. It all depends on the purpose of your site. If you want to continually drive the same traffic back to your site, you’ll constantly need to add more content, such as new products or a regular blog. Also, if information about your company or products and services changes then you need to keep your website updated with the latest information.

Most websites have a lot of static content (content that does not change). If this is all you have then maybe you need to update your site twice a year.

The important thing to remember is that out-of-date content can hurt you with search rankings, but updating too often just for the sake of the search engines can also hurt your rankings. The best approach is to fine-tune the content you do have and make sure it is relevant to the search terms and keywords that you target for search results.

Q. Can I make my own updates and changes to the site?

Yes! We build our website using WordPress, which is 100% self-administering, allowing the site owner to update information as needed. There is a learning curve, but we do provide training for a fee. We do prefer you allow us to handle any major changes on the site, however.

Q. How long before my site shows up in the search engine search results?

It will vary with each search engine and directory. After a site is launched and submitted to the search engines, it can take 4-6 weeks before a search engine like Google will index your site (add it to their database). Then it can take up to 3months for your site to begin showing up in search results. It probably will not show up in the first three pages of results for up to 6 months, if at all.

There are many factors involved in how your site will rank in searches. Some of these factors include where your business is located in relation to the person searching, the category you are in, how competitive the market is, and the actual search term that was used by the person searching. It is very difficult to optimize a website for every conceivable search term.

Beware of companies that tell you they can have your site showing up immediately on the first page of Google. These are generally scams.
